make a paste with a bio washing powder and water , wet the tshirt. put said paste on the stain. agitate the area between hands, leave overnight but dont let the shirt or the paste dry out

agitate well betwen hands then wash on a normal wash cycle. ta da. clean stain free tshirt.

when I was working on oily machines my overalls used to get soaked overnight in a bucket of water and washing powder as it starts to break the oil down before getting a good wash.
